Merck partners with ADAP Crisis Task Force to expand access to New HIV Treatment IDVYNSO™

Merck on Monday announced a new agreement with the ADAP Crisis Task Force aimed at improving access to its recently approved HIV treatment, IDVYNSO™ (doravirine/islatravir). This collaboration is designed to help state AIDS Drug Assistance Programs (ADAPs) provide the once-daily, two-drug single-tablet regimen to eligible individuals across the United States.

State ADAPs currently provide vital support to more than 250,000 people living with HIV in the U.S., making them a critical component of the healthcare safety net for uninsured or underserved populations.

“ADAP programs play a critical role in supporting access to treatment for people living with HIV who are uninsured or underserved,” Tim Horn, director of Medication Access at the National Alliance of State and Territorial AIDS Directors (NASTAD), said. “We appreciate Merck’s continued engagement and its willingness to work collaboratively to help address the critical access challenges facing state ADAP programs.”

Conrod Kelly, U.S. HIV business unit head at Merck, emphasized the company’s focus on bridging gaps in treatment. “This agreement reflects our long-standing commitment to working with the ACTF, state ADAPs, and the HIV community to strengthen access and help address persistent gaps in care,” Kelly said.

Approved by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in April 2026, IDVYNSO is a fixed-dose combination of doravirine—a non-n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itor (NNRTI)—and islatravir, a next-generation nucleoside analog reverse transcriptase inhibitor (NRTI).

The medication is indicated for the treatment of HIV-1 infection in adults who are already virologically suppressed (HIV-1 RNA less than 50 copies per mL) on a stable antiretroviral regimen, provided they have no history of virologic treatment failure and no known resistance to doravirine.

Merck has established the Merck Access Program to assist patients and health care providers with navigating coverage, estimated out-of-pocket costs, and co-pay assistance options for eligible, commercially insured individuals.
